I shipped two Dobyns rods to VA last year in a pvc tube with foam inside at each end and caps bolted in place and taped via USPS. They bent the PVC and broke both rods.🤦♂️ I had paid for extra insurance. It took 3 months of submitting and resubmitting claim before they finally honored the insurance and paid off. Won’t ever make that mistake again!
